Chris Brown and Rihanna, who reunited at Sean "Diddy" Combs' Miami home a few weeks after Brown was accused of attacking his superstar girlfriend, are now reportedly "taking a break," a source told E!.
The "break" is not an official breakup, but the two have decided to spend some time apart, the source said.
Brown and Rihanna were on opposite coasts over the weekend. While he remained in Los Angeles to work on his album, Rihanna jetted to New York City, where she dined with Brandy, Beyonce and Jay-Z Friday night at the Spotted Pig. On Saturday, she enjoyed dinner with friends at Da Silvano.
Like Brown, the 21-year-old is also working on new music, producer Evan Rogers told Entertainment Weekly. He added that singer is "very aware" of the advice Oprah, Dr. Phil and Tyra Banks have tried to give her via their domestic violence specials last week.
"I think that it matters to her, but there's a line that she walks between being human and caring when you hear these kinds of things, and separating your personal life from your professional life," Rogers said. "She's doing the best she can and this is a very difficult time that she's going through right now and she's going to learn a lot from it."
While a TVGuide.com poll says Rihanna will face fan fallout, Rogers doesn't believe that to be the case.
"I think that when the dust settles, she's going to be fine," he said. "The bottom line is Rihanna is a superstar and like other artists, the reception from her fans will mostly depend on how good an album she makes next time out and how great the songs are."
